Bagaimana 'Disable' Mempengaruhi Pengalaman Pengguna dalam Aplikasi Mobile?

essays-star 4 (307 suara)

Elemen antarmuka yang dinonaktifkan, yang ditandai dengan tampilan yang redup atau tidak responsif, menyampaikan ketidakaktifan sementara atau permanen suatu fitur. Artikel ini akan membahas tentang bagaimana elemen yang dinonaktifkan memengaruhi pengalaman pengguna dalam aplikasi mobile.

Signifikansi 'Disable' dalam Desain Aplikasi

Dalam desain aplikasi mobile, 'disable' memainkan peran penting dalam mengkomunikasikan status dan mencegah kesalahan pengguna. Ketika suatu elemen dinonaktifkan, itu secara visual mengindikasikan kepada pengguna bahwa elemen tersebut saat ini tidak tersedia untuk interaksi. Hal ini membantu mencegah pengguna dari frustrasi karena mencoba berinteraksi dengan elemen yang tidak responsif. Selain itu, 'disable' dapat digunakan untuk memandu pengguna melalui alur kerja dengan menonaktifkan opsi yang tidak relevan atau belum tersedia.

Dampak 'Disable' pada Pengalaman Pengguna

'Disable' yang diterapkan dengan baik dapat meningkatkan kegunaan dan kepuasan pengguna. Dengan memberikan indikasi visual yang jelas tentang elemen mana yang aktif dan tidak aktif, 'disable' membantu pengguna memahami bagaimana berinteraksi dengan aplikasi secara efektif. Selain itu, 'disable' dapat mencegah kesalahan dengan menonaktifkan tindakan yang berpotensi merusak atau tidak valid.

Sebaliknya, 'disable' yang diterapkan dengan buruk dapat membingungkan dan membuat frustrasi pengguna. Misalnya, jika suatu elemen dinonaktifkan tetapi tidak ada indikasi visual yang jelas mengapa, pengguna mungkin bingung mengapa mereka tidak dapat berinteraksi dengannya. Demikian pula, jika suatu aplikasi menggunakan 'disable' secara berlebihan, itu dapat membuat antarmuka terasa kikuk dan sulit digunakan.

Praktik Terbaik untuk Menerapkan 'Disable'

Untuk memastikan bahwa 'disable' digunakan secara efektif dalam aplikasi mobile, perancang harus mengikuti praktik terbaik tertentu. Pertama, mereka harus memastikan bahwa ada indikasi visual yang jelas tentang elemen mana yang dinonaktifkan. Ini dapat dicapai dengan menggunakan warna redup, bayangan, atau label teks untuk menunjukkan status elemen yang dinonaktifkan.

Kedua, perancang harus memberikan umpan balik yang jelas kepada pengguna ketika mereka mencoba berinteraksi dengan elemen yang dinonaktifkan. Ini dapat berupa pesan sederhana yang menjelaskan mengapa elemen tersebut dinonaktifkan atau petunjuk visual seperti perubahan warna atau animasi.

Terakhir, perancang harus menggunakan 'disable' secara hemat dan hanya jika diperlukan. Menonaktifkan terlalu banyak elemen dapat membuat antarmuka terasa kikuk dan sulit digunakan.

Menyeimbangkan 'Disable' dan Kejelasan

Salah satu tantangan utama dalam menggunakan 'disable' adalah menyeimbangkan kebutuhan akan kejelasan dengan keinginan untuk menjaga antarmuka tetap bersih dan tidak berantakan. Perancang harus berusaha untuk memberikan indikasi visual yang jelas tentang elemen mana yang dinonaktifkan tanpa mengacaukan antarmuka atau membingungkan pengguna.

Salah satu pendekatan untuk mencapai keseimbangan ini adalah dengan menggunakan 'disable' selektif. Misalnya, alih-alih menonaktifkan seluruh bagian antarmuka, perancang dapat memilih untuk hanya menonaktifkan elemen tertentu yang tidak relevan atau tidak tersedia. Ini dapat membantu menjaga antarmuka tetap bersih dan mudah digunakan sambil tetap memberikan kejelasan kepada pengguna.

Kesimpulan

'Disable' adalah alat penting yang dapat digunakan untuk meningkatkan pengalaman pengguna dalam aplikasi mobile. Dengan memahami dampak 'disable' pada perilaku pengguna dan mengikuti praktik terbaik untuk penerapan, perancang dapat menciptakan aplikasi yang ramah pengguna, efisien, dan memuaskan untuk digunakan.